Letter of Intent The Letter of Intent (LOI) is a new national initiative that is designed to reduce and limit the recruiting pressures on prospective student-athletes, to educate prospective student-athletes on the most applicable U SPORTS regulations, and to assist coaches in their recruiting efforts.
